  • Reports to the Manager, Patient Care Services. Performs receptionist and general clerical duties relating to the general functioning of the patient care unit. Assists with basic patient care activities in support of other unit team members. Specific tasks to be performed are determined based upon assignment and may include some or all of the duties listed below.

Receives guests, communicates information and performs other receptionist and clerical duties by:

    • Greeting visitors, patients, personnel and physicians in a pleasant and courteous manner.
    • Answering the telephone promptly and taking and relaying messages for physicians, nurses, patients, etc. in a timely, courteous and accurate manner.
    • Preparing patient charts for admission, transfer and discharge.
    • Monitoring and communicating medical record data received via printers and fax machines.

Inputs a variety of data into the patient information system by:

    • Transcribing and inputting physicians' orders into the computer accurately and in a timely manner.
    • Entering all charges daily and immediately upon discharge or transfer.
    • Entering and updating transfers, discharges, conditions and other clinical data using information provided.

Supports the patient care unit operations by:

    • Performing patient care responsibilities which are determined by the unit assignment (i.e., taking and recording vital signs, performing EKGs, assisting with admission and discharge activities, providing nourishments and/or linens etc.).
    • Answering patient call lights, addressing the need and/or relaying messages appropriately.
    • Transporting (by wheelchair or cart) or accompanying patients to other areas.
    • Inventorying, ordering, delivering, picking up, putting away and checking for outdated supplies.
    • Maintaining neatness of work areas and supply area.
    • Requesting repairs or services from Environmental Services, Plant Engineering, Bio-medical & Communication Services, etc.

Performs other functions to maintain personal competence and contribute to the overall effectiveness of the department by:

    • Completing other job-related duties as assigned, with appropriate skill validation as defined by the department.

Education and Experience

  • The knowledge, skills and abilities as indicated below are normally acquired through the successful completion of a high school diploma or equivalent. Previous clerical experience required.

Knowledge & Skills

  • Requires knowledge and understanding of medical terminology.
  • Demonstrates legible printing or writing and accuracy in spelling medical and non-medical terms.
  • Demonstrates ability to read, transcribe and follow directions and policies and procedures (for example, x-ray preparations and lab test requirements).
  • Requires computer skills and sufficient keyboarding skills to complete the work assigned accurately and in a reasonable amount of time.
  • Demonstrates the communication and interpersonal skills necessary to interact effectively with patients, visitors and team members and to maintain positive working relationships.
  • Demonstrates well-developed telephone skills in order to relay information promptly and accurately.
  • Requires the ability to work with minimal supervision, handle multiple activities and prioritize work.

Working Conditions

  • Works in a patient care area with frequent changes in job demands and the remote possibility of exposure to bio-hazards.

Physical Demands

  • Requires the physical ability and stamina (i.e., to push wheelchairs and carts, provide CPR and lift objects weighing at least 50 pounds, etc.) to perform the essential functions of the position.
